Closer Look at Casper FFG and Ethereum PoS

In the research article, the Polkadot and Ethereum developer presented a SNARK-based approach for verifying Ethereum’s Casper FFG consensus proofs. Notably, the SNARK-based scaling solution is famous among many layer two protocols since it uses a non-interactive smaller proof than the data it represents.

In this research article I present a SNARK based scheme for verifying the Ethereum’s Casper FFG consensus proofs.

With this scheme on/offchain light clients can benefit from the crypto economic security provided by the ETH 17m ($34b) at stake.

— Web3 Philosopher (@seunlanlege) May 11, 2023

Although the Casper FFG uses a rather simple consensus mechanism, its proof of security has been described as rather difficult than normal. Moreover, Casper FFG is a Practical Byzantine Fault Tolerance (PBFT) inspired and improved consensus protocol. The Ethereum core developers argue in this direction since PBFT is characterized by a two-round voting mechanism that is permissionless, leader-based, and security-oriented.

According to Buterin, the key goal of Casper is to achieve economic finality.

“Economic finality is accomplished in Casper by requiring validators to submit deposits to participate, and taking away their deposits if the protocol determines that they acted in some way that violates some set of rules (“slashing conditions”),” Buterin noted in a Medium post.

Notably, the Ethereum beacon chain has significantly grown since the Merge event last year and currently has more than 18.3 million ether staked by more than 576k validators. With the SNARK-based scheme for verifying the Ethereum’s Casper FFG consensus proofs introduced by Seun Lanlege, both on and off-chain light clients can benefit from the crypto economic security provided by the ETH 17m ($34b) at stake.

“This protocol offers full node-level security that is orders of magnitude more secure than the sync committee, and is fully Byzantine fault-tolerant,” Lanlege noted.

Notably, Lanlege presented a detailed mathematical proof expression to show that the protocol is a more ambitious approach to directly verifying the Casper FFG consensus proofs.
